The cheapest way to get from Metz to Dunkirk is to bus which costs €35 - €75 and takes 8h 31m.
The fastest way to get from Metz to Dunkirk is to drive which takes 4h 20m and costs €60 - €95.
No, there is no direct bus from Metz station to Dunkirk station. However, there are services departing from Metz - Bus Station and arriving at Dunkirk - Pôle d'Échange Station via Brussels - Midi Train Station and Lille - Europe Train Station.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 8h 31m.
No, there is no direct train from Metz to Dunkirk. However, there are services departing from Metz Ville and arriving at Dunkerque via Paris Nord.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 4h 44m.
The distance between Metz and Dunkirk is 605 km. The road distance is 420.8 km.
The best way to get from Metz to Dunkirk without a car is to train via Paris which takes 4h 44m and costs €110 - €200.
It takes approximately 4h 44m to get from Metz to Dunkirk, including transfers.
Metz to Dunkirk bus services, operated by BlaBlaCar Bus, depart from Metz - Bus Station.
Metz to Dunkirk train services, operated by TGV inOui, depart from Metz Ville station.
The best way to get from Metz to Dunkirk is to train via Paris which takes 4h 44m and costs €110 - €200. Alternatively, you can bus, which costs €35 - €75 and takes 8h 31m.
